Inspection history vs New Jersey & national averages
Cycle 1 is the most recent standard health inspection. Lower total deficiency counts are better.
| Cycle | Inspection date | This facility | New Jersey avg | National avg | v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 2024-12-16 | 10 | 8.6 | 9.5 | +1.4 worse |
| 2 | 2023-11-09 | 11 | 8.0 | 9.8 | +3.0 worse |
| 3 | 2022-11-03 | 16 | 4.9 | 9.3 | +11.1 worse |
